Zipkin Decorator¶
-
class
swagger_zipkin.zipkin_decorator.ZipkinClientDecorator(client)¶ A wrapper to swagger client (swagger-py or bravado) to pass on zipkin headers to the service call.
Even though client is initialised once, all the calls made will have independent spans.
Parameters: client ( swaggerpy.client.SwaggerClientorbravado.client.SwaggerClient.) – Swagger Client
-
class
swagger_zipkin.zipkin_decorator.ZipkinResourceDecorator(resource)¶ A wrapper to the swagger resource.
Parameters: resource ( swaggerpy.client.Resourceorbravado_core.resource.Resource) – A resource object. eg. client.pet, client.store.